Ecopetrol to issue $2 billion in bonds
Wednesday, April 16, 2014

Ecopetrol won authorization from Colombia’s Finance Ministry to sell as much as $2 billion in overseas bonds by 2016.
The state-controlled oil producer seeks funding for exploration and production.
Colombia’s biggest company is struggling to meet output targets amid a surge in pipeline attacks by Marxist guerrillas, and plans to invest $75 billion through 2020 to boost output by 63 percent.
